Karaoke Machines Market Overview

Global karaoke machines market size is anticipated to be valued at USD 795.9 million in 2024, with a projected growth to USD 942.78 million by 2033 at a CAGR of 1.9%.

The karaoke machines market is experiencing robust demand globally, driven by the increasing popularity of music-based entertainment. Over 21.3 million karaoke systems were in active use globally by 2024. Karaoke machines, widely used across residential, commercial, and outdoor venues, have evolved with technological advancements, including Bluetooth connectivity, smart integration, and wireless microphones. Japan leads in karaoke adoption, with over 100,000 karaoke establishments, while the U.S. market has seen a significant increase in household-based karaoke systems, with more than 3.7 million households owning personal karaoke setups in 2023.

The rise of portable karaoke machines and smart karaoke systems has pushed sales volume across Asia-Pacific and North America. In 2023, more than 56% of new karaoke systems sold were wireless and Bluetooth-enabled. Demand for AI-enabled voice effects and multi-language support has also grown, particularly in Europe and Southeast Asia. Product innovation and strategic branding are fueling intense competition among manufacturers, leading to over 1,100 new karaoke products launched globally between 2022 and 2024. With social entertainment gaining popularity, the karaoke machines market is expanding rapidly into younger demographics and emerging economies.

Karaoke Machines Market Trends

The karaoke machines market has been significantly shaped by several key trends between 2022 and 2024. One prominent trend is the rising demand for portable karaoke systems. These accounted for 56% of total market sales in 2023, as users favored mobility and convenience. Bluetooth connectivity, built-in LED lighting, and rechargeable batteries are now standard in over 75% of portable models.

A second major trend is the integration of smart technology. Smart karaoke machines with touchscreens, app control, Wi-Fi connectivity, and song libraries in excess of 50,000 tracks have surged in popularity. In 2023, over 39% of newly sold units featured smartphone integration, compared to 22% in 2021.

Another trend is the growing customization of karaoke systems for children and family use. More than 1.5 million karaoke machines sold in 2023 were designed for children under 12, featuring child-safe microphones, pre-set music playlists, and volume limiters. Families now represent over 40% of the customer base for karaoke machines.

The venue-specific demand remains strong in Asia-Pacific and the Middle East. In Southeast Asia, over 68,000 new karaoke machines were installed in bars, KTV lounges, and restaurants in 2023. In contrast, North America has witnessed a shift toward home-based entertainment, with over 3.7 million home users in the U.S. alone.

Sustainability and eco-designs have also emerged. Manufacturers are now offering models with recycled plastic housings and low-energy consumption amplifiers. Around 11% of karaoke systems sold in Europe in 2024 were made with recycled materials.

Karaoke Machines Market Dynamics

DRIVER

Rising demand for portable entertainment devices.

The growth in consumer preference for compact, mobile, and tech-enabled music systems is significantly fueling the demand for karaoke machines. In 2023, portable systems represented 56% of total global sales. Consumers increasingly favor devices with rechargeable batteries, wireless microphones, and Bluetooth compatibility. Over 48% of portable systems now include dual-mic support and LED party lighting features. The convenience of transporting and setting up these devices has made them especially popular for home parties, outdoor gatherings, and travel use. Additionally, portable karaoke systems appeal to a wide demographic, including teenagers, families, and content creators.

RESTRAINT

Increasing market saturation and refurbished product circulation.

The proliferation of low-cost alternatives and refurbished karaoke machines is posing a threat to premium brands. In 2023, more than 18% of karaoke machine sales in Southeast Asia came from refurbished or second-hand systems. This trend, while beneficial for affordability, hampers new unit sales. Furthermore, the influx of unbranded imports has flooded markets in Latin America and parts of Africa with substandard products, impacting consumer trust and product longevity. Saturation in key markets like Japan and South Korea, where over 90% of commercial venues already possess karaoke systems, also limits growth potential.

OPPORTUNITY

Growth in AI-integrated and multilingual karaoke systems.

Advancements in AI are opening up new opportunities in the karaoke machines market. In 2023, over 280,000 AI-enabled karaoke units were sold globally. These machines include pitch-correction, voice-enhancement filters, and AI song recommendations based on vocal range. Additionally, growing demand for multilingual karaoke systems is creating openings in multicultural countries. More than 62% of units sold in Canada and Singapore now support three or more languages. This trend is further enhanced by cloud-based song libraries that allow updates and localization on demand, encouraging higher user engagement and broader adoption.

CHALLENGE

Rising costs of materials and components.

The manufacturing of karaoke machines involves components such as amplifiers, LCD screens, wireless chips, and microphones. In 2023, global supply chain disruptions and rising costs of lithium batteries, semiconductors, and steel increased the average production cost per unit by 18%. These cost pressures have led to price increases of 12% in some markets, reducing affordability. Additionally, regulatory challenges around electronic waste disposal, particularly in the EU, require costly compliance adjustments by manufacturers, further constraining their operational efficiency.

Karaoke Machines Market Segmentation

The karaoke machines market is segmented by type and application. By type, the market comprises fixed systems and portable systems. By application, it is segmented into home, venue-based (bars/restaurants/KTV), and outdoor use. Each segment plays a crucial role in the global distribution of over 21.3 million karaoke machines in use worldwide in 2024.

By Type

  • Fixed System: Fixed karaoke machines, primarily installed in commercial venues, are characterized by higher sound output, robust amplifiers, and integrated display systems. These systems account for approximately 41% of the market in 2023. Over 78,000 new fixed systems were installed in Japan and China in 2023. These models typically include wall-mounted speakers, touchscreen song selection, and professional-level mixing capabilities. They are preferred in karaoke lounges and event halls where durable, high-performance systems are essential.
  • Portable System: Portable karaoke systems dominate the market with 56% share as of 2023. Over 8.9 million units sold globally in 2023 were portable. These devices include handheld microphones, suitcase-style speakers, built-in screens, and smart features. A rise in demand was seen across North America, where 2.1 million portable karaoke machines were sold in 2023. Lightweight builds, rechargeable batteries, and compatibility with mobile apps make them ideal for at-home and travel use. The sub-$150 price category for portable systems is especially attractive to first-time users and youth.

By Application

  • Home: Home-based use leads the market with over 9.2 million active units in 2023. The growing trend of in-home entertainment, particularly after the COVID-19 pandemic, has driven massive adoption. Over 43% of U.S. users reported using karaoke machines for family gatherings or parties. Wi-Fi connectivity, integrated display panels, and remote song selection features are highly valued.
  • For Venue (Bar/Restaurant/KTV): Commercial use of karaoke machines, particularly in bars and restaurants, accounted for over 6.7 million units globally. In China alone, over 19,000 new KTV establishments installed karaoke systems in 2023. These systems prioritize sound output, multi-mic input, and large screen compatibility for immersive group singing experiences.
  • Outdoors: Outdoor usage is on the rise, with 2.3 million units used in parks, public events, and community centers globally. Weatherproofing, extended battery life (6+ hours), and built-in PA systems are key attributes. Asia-Pacific countries, especially the Philippines and Thailand, show strong outdoor adoption rates.

Karaoke Machines Market Regional Outlook

The karaoke machines market shows varied performance across global regions. Asia-Pacific remains dominant due to cultural preference and venue density, while North America and Europe are experiencing a shift toward home-based entertainment systems. The Middle East and Africa show emerging potential, particularly in urban entertainment sectors.

  • North America

North America accounted for over 3.7 million active karaoke systems in 2023. The U.S. leads with 2.9 million, followed by Canada with 520,000 units. The portable segment dominates with 67% market share in the region. Smart integration, such as Alexa and Google Home compatibility, has gained significant traction. Online purchases now represent over 73% of total karaoke system sales in the region, highlighting a mature digital retail ecosystem.

  • Europe

Europe shows increasing adoption, particularly in France, Germany, and the U.K. Over 2.2 million karaoke machines were sold in 2023. Fixed systems in hospitality venues remain popular, with Germany alone having over 5,000 commercial karaoke venues. Sustainability is a strong selling point, with over 11% of devices sold in Europe featuring eco-friendly components and energy-efficient circuitry.

  • Asia-Pacific

Asia-Pacific dominates with over 11.6 million systems in active use. Japan and South Korea are mature markets, while Southeast Asia, especially Thailand and Indonesia, is growing rapidly. China installed over 19,000 new commercial units in 2023. The region’s cultural affinity for singing, combined with rapid urbanization and a large youth population, fuels the growth. Demand for multilingual support and AI integration is particularly high in South Korea and Singapore.

  • Middle East & Africa

The Middle East & Africa region is emerging, with approximately 1.3 million units in use. Saudi Arabia and UAE lead due to their strong hospitality sector, with over 1,200 new installations in hotels and event spaces in 2023. Africa, particularly Nigeria and South Africa, shows promise through mobile-based karaoke solutions. Language diversity drives demand for customizable playlists.

Investment Analysis and Opportunities

The karaoke machines market has experienced increased investment across technology development, market expansion, and branding from both new entrants and established manufacturers. In 2023, over 41 major product development and expansion initiatives were recorded globally, with companies directing capital towards research, AI integration, and software upgrades. Japan, the United States, and South Korea remain the top investment hubs, accounting for over 60% of total karaoke-related R&D activity.

Notably, private equity firms and venture capitalists have become more active in backing entertainment tech companies that focus on karaoke systems. In 2023, five notable investment rounds raised a combined USD-equivalent of over $180 million for smart karaoke start-ups developing AI-based singing assistants, mobile app-linked devices, and cloud-based karaoke platforms.

Manufacturers are also heavily investing in voice-recognition algorithms and multi-user scoring systems to enhance the karaoke experience. In 2024, over 19% of new karaoke machine models featured advanced vocal analysis, enabling detailed feedback and gamification options. These developments aim to capture the attention of the gaming community and younger demographics seeking more interactive content.

Market opportunities are also growing in underserved regions. In Africa and parts of Latin America, karaoke equipment is gaining popularity in public spaces and youth centers. To address affordability, manufacturers are investing in low-cost modular karaoke systems. These entry-level systems can be upgraded over time, and in 2023 alone, over 680,000 such units were sold globally.

OEM partnerships and distribution investments are also expanding. By 2024, over 48% of karaoke machine manufacturers had formed joint ventures with regional distributors or consumer electronics firms to improve logistics and reduce shipping times. This has increased availability in Tier 2 and Tier 3 cities in countries like India, Mexico, and Brazil.

New Product Development

Innovation in the karaoke machines market has accelerated, driven by consumer demand for smart features, portability, and immersive experiences. Between 2023 and 2024, over 1,100 new karaoke machine models were launched globally, many of which introduced cutting-edge design and functionality upgrades.

One of the most notable innovations is the integration of Artificial Intelligence for pitch correction, vocal coaching, and performance grading. By 2024, over 22% of newly launched karaoke machines featured AI-based singing enhancements. These systems provide real-time feedback on pitch, rhythm, and vocal range, attracting users who seek both entertainment and personal improvement.

Manufacturers have also introduced voice-controlled karaoke systems, compatible with smart home ecosystems. Devices launched in 2023 by leading brands included models that could be operated via voice commands to search songs, adjust volume, and switch settings hands-free. Over 500,000 such units were sold globally within a year of release.

Child-focused karaoke machines have emerged as a fast-growing segment. In 2023, over 1.5 million child-safe karaoke machines were sold, designed with interactive LED lighting, storybook modes, and character themes. These units come with built-in nursery rhymes, volume limiters, and durable build quality for safe usage.

Another major innovation is multi-room karaoke systems, enabling synchronized audio and lyrics across multiple speakers and displays. Over 210,000 of such units were sold across hospitality venues and event spaces in 2023. This supports large groups and enhances user engagement in commercial settings.

Five Recent Developments

  • Singing Machine: launched the Carpool Karaoke 2.0 Bluetooth system in 2023, which integrates voice effects and car speaker connectivity. Over 140,000 units were sold within 8 months of launch in North America.
  • Daiichikosho: released a multilingual karaoke system in 2023 with support for 12 languages and AI-based song suggestions, targeting international KTV venues across Asia-Pacific. The product has been installed in over 9,500 locations.
  • Pioneer: introduced a touch-free control interface for its commercial karaoke models in early 2024, driven by hygiene concerns. Sales of these models increased by 22% year-over-year.
  • Ion Audio: unveiled a solar-powered karaoke machine in 2023, designed for outdoor and rural areas. The system includes 6-hour battery life and weather-resistant casing, with over 87,000 units sold across emerging markets.
  • TJ Media: partnered with a streaming platform in 2024 to allow users to access licensed karaoke content from mobile apps. Over 3 million users engaged with the feature in the first six months post-launch.
